|
Page 9 sur 9 b
- MRTG
Pour
pouvoir installer MRTG, il est nécessaire d’avoir la présence d’un serveur
WEB comme Apache et de modules Perl supplémentaires à ceux qui sont déjà présent.
Dans
ce chapitre, seul le fonctionnement de MRTG sera expliqué :
MRTG
peut être découper en deux modules :
Le
Collecteur :
Il
va régulièrement aller chercher les valeurs à mesurer sur les systèmes distants,
via SNMP. Par exemple, une des fonctions de bases de ce logiciel est de représenter
graphiquement le trafic réseau.
Pour
cela il va récupérer les valeurs des OID :
ifInOctets
ifOutOctets
pour
chaque interface. Puis le collecteur stock ces variables dans des fichiers
textes ou des bases de donnés (comme RRD Tool par exemple).
Le
Grapheur :
C’est
l’autre partie du logiciel, il va utiliser les informations trouvées précédemment
pour générer des courbes de trafic. Selon le système utilisé, il pourra même
générer ces graphiques à la demande (avec les RRD tools par exemple).
MRTG
permettent de collecter et de grapher tout et n’importe quoi, à partir du
moment où c’est interrogeable par SNMP (ou via un script) : la température
d’un routeur, le nombre de requêtes HTTP, etc.
à
les sources :
Site
de NET-SNMP : http://net-snmp.sourceforge.net/
Site
de MRTG : http://people.ee.ethz.ch/~oetiker/webtools/mrtg/
Linux
Mag
voir RFC concernant
SNMP
RFC 1157
RFC 1905
RFC 1906
RFC 1907
RFC 2571
RFC 2572
RFC 2573
RFC 2574
RFC 2575
|